【技术实现步骤摘要】
一种基于Aloha协议的多空口网络吞吐量优化方法
[0001]本专利技术涉及无线通信的
,特别涉及一种基于Aloha协议的多空口网络吞吐量优化方法。
技术介绍
[0002]时隙Aloha(S
‑
Aloha,Slotted
‑
Aloha)协议作为一种经典的介质访问控制(MAC)方案,将传输时间拆分为若干个离散的时隙,允许用户设备在不受集中调度的情形下共享无线信道资源,对众多无线传输技术和网络系统中有着重要的作用。
[0003]随着网络系统的不断演进和无线通信环境的逐渐复杂,单空口设备SRD(SRD,Single
‑
radioDevice)有限的数据传输能力已经难以满足水涨船高的未来通信服务质量的多样化需求,SRD的局限性推动了多空口技术的诞生和发展。多空口技术允许在单个多空口设备MRD(MRD,Multi
‑
radioDevice)内部聚合多个空中接口(air
‑
interface),从而具备了在不同链路上的同时传输和接收的 ...
【技术保护点】
【技术特征摘要】
1.一种基于Aloha协议的多空口网络吞吐量优化方法,其特征在于,包括以下:S1.在网络内建立基于Aloha协议的多空口网络吞吐量优化系统,所述系统包括多个单空口设备SRD和多个多空口设备MRD;S2.确定网络内可用信道的数量和各信道上的单空口设备SRD数量,按信道将网络中的单空口设备SRD划分为若干个空口设备单元,将网络中的所有多空口设备MRD划分在同一个多空口设备单元;S3.由多空口设备单元中的多空口设备MRD分别统计不同设备单元内的设备的数量和吞吐量公平性约束比例;S4.判断单空口设备单元内的单空口设备SRD是否存在吞吐量公平性需求,若是,根据各设备单元设备数量设定各设备单元达到网络最大吞吐量所需的最优传输概率,执行S5;否则,根据各设备单元的设备数量和吞吐量公平性约束比例设定各设备单元达到网络最大吞吐量所需的最优传输概率,执行S5;S5.经过预设时间后,利用多空口设备单元收集各设备单元的吞吐量,根据收集的各设备单元的吞吐量获取网络的总吞吐量;S6.判断网络是否处于最佳工作状态或网络内的各设备单元中是否出现新的设备,若是,则返回S1;否则,维持当前网络状态。2.根据权利要求1所述的基于Aloha协议的多空口网络吞吐量优化方法,其特征在于,在步骤S1中,每一个单空口设备SRD均设有单个无线电台,每一个多空口设备MRD均设有多个无线电台。3.根据权利要求2所述的基于Aloha协议的多空口网络吞吐量优化方法,其特征在于,设网络内可用信道的数量为L
m
,将网络内的单空口设备SRD划分为L个单空口设备单元,L≤L
m
,并将网络中所有多空口设备MRD划分在同一个多空口设备单元,设为第M个设备单元;通过多空口设备MRD分别统计L+1个设备单元内的设备数量n
(i)
,i∈{1,2,
…
,L,M}和L个单空口设备单元中设备的吞吐量公平性约束比例β
(g)
≥0,g∈{1,2,
…
,L},其中,β
(g)
表示第g个单空口设备单元的单元吞吐量与多空口设备单元在第g条信道上的相应吞吐量的比例关系。4.根据权利要求3所述的基于Aloha协议的多空口网络吞吐量优化方法,其特征在于,所述每一个设备均依照传输概率q
(i)
∈(0,1)发起传输请求。5.根据权利要求3所述的基于Aloha协议的多空口网络吞吐量优化方法,其特征在于,在步骤S2中,所述可用信道的数量L
m
不超过多空口设备单元中的所有多空口设备MRD的无线电台数量,若单空口设备单元内的设备无最低吞吐量需求,则将相应的吞吐量公平性约束比例值β
(g)
设为0,并传输至多空口设备单元。6.根据权利要求4所述的基于Aloha协议的多空口网络吞吐量优化方法,其特征在于,在步骤S4中,每个单空口设备单元和多空口设备单元均以最优传输概率发起传输请求。7.根据权利要求6所述的基于Aloha协议的多空口网络吞吐量优化方法,其特征在于,在步骤S4中,若β
(g)
...
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。